Output 4dea79014c2b265ddb53179e44886c9942c66de7f11e4f0a79830e7d4642a9fe:23

value
1068344
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bf07a369e08a36bb4cd94099585884bd3040ce33 OP_EQUAL
address
3K768uPmPWN5cnXocMRgDkTZbEQ1S39WzK
transaction
4dea79014c2b265ddb53179e44886c9942c66de7f11e4f0a79830e7d4642a9fe
spent
true